so im buying a bike
im pretty much a new rider. i have a yz250 dirtbike but ive only had it for half a summer so i didnt get a whole lot of experience. im looking for a bike that wont kill me on insurance, or kill me in general. somewhere between a 500 and a 600. i have about $4500 to spend. your thoughts?

like I said, check out a Thundercat (yzf600r). also try a suzuki SV650 (sv650s if you're not a fan of naked [i.e. no fairings] bikes). the SV has a vtwin so it has more torque, which makes it a lil easier to pop it up at slow speeds, but it's generally looked upon as a decent starter bike. there's also a gs/es500, kinda in between the 250s and 600s. or even the new ninja 650 if you want to put that cash down and make payments. go to dealerships and sit on the bikes to see which one is most comfortable. those supersport 600s are pretty much race bikes, meaning you're more leaned over and therefore uncomfortable. my bike has much better ergonomics for longer riding (i've ridden from sacramento to fresno, a 150 mile ride, with no stops and was only a lil sore. if i was on a supersport my back and shoulders would be killing me), and is just generally better for a daily street ride. why buy a racebike for the street, when all you need is a streetbike?
basically, don't worry about getting a sexy sportbike for a first bike. chicks still dig 250s, and they dig guys who are talented enough to stay on their bikes and not hurt themselves because they wanted the latest greatest shiny sportbike
